China Receives First Advanced Su-35 Flankers From Russia
Chinese state media confirmed delivery in late December of four of the aircraft. China signed a $2 billion contract with Russia in 2015 for the acquisition of 24 Su-35s, following more than five years of on-again, off-again negotiations for the aircraft.
